Ayr overcame Marr in a high-scoring west coast derby at Millbrae, as the men in pink and black continue their hunt for a place on the top of the table (33-22).

The home side drew first blood, as a neat chip and chase by Scott Lyle saw him add the first points to the scoreboard for Ayr. Lyle was successful with the boot to add the extras.

He was soon joined on the scoresheet by David Armstrong, who dived over the line on the back of a well-taken line-out.

Marr were quick on the response, as Ross Miller and Richard Dalgleish powered their way through the defence to score.

However, Ayr soon found their rhythm again, as Grant Anderson and Frazier Climo both crossed the whitewash before half-time and secured the all-important bonus point for Ayr.

Half-time: Ayr 28 – 10 Marr

After the interval, a neat grubber kick by Ayr resulted in Robbie Nairn gathering the ball and scurrying over the line.

The second-half saw Marr enjoy greater periods of possession and attack, as the plucky men from Fullarton tried to stage a comeback – with both Angus Johnston and Ross Miller brushing past the defence to score.

Despite the late surge Marr were unable to catch up, yet were not left too disheartened as their efforts saw them leave Millbrae with a vital bonus point.

Full-time: Ayr 33 – 22 Marr

The remaining BT Premiership fixtures were postponed due to unplayable pitches.
